If you have debt problems, you may find it problematic to create a new bank-account. Exactly why is this the case? The simple reason you might be having numerous problems starting a bank account is Chex Systems. And so what is the deal with this structure? This organization is a organization that deals with poor credit consumer banking history. If a banking client has committed some type of financial fraud or even has written bad checks in the past, it could be nearly impossible to open a fresh banking account. One type of financial institution which might not make use of this special database are credit union banks -- a majority of these are usually smaller sized neighborhood mom-and-pop kind of banking institutions and you have a higher chance to open a completely new bank account even though you have your name on the ChexSystems database. You might have to actually telephone banking institutions and directly ask if they employ the list or not. Consumer banking companies are unwilling to publicly state if they employ this special record system or don't use it. This is the reason why you are going to have to call. Also consider getting a bank-account specifically made for people with bad credit -- these accounts are often called bank accounts for people with bad credit. Now these are unique no credit check bank account that offer customers who've been turned down from other banks a chance to open a whole new checking account. Getting a second chance bank account for people with banking problems is an effective option, but it is usually the more costly option because there are a number of additional fees you pay for the privalage of having one of these accounts. 2nd Chance Accounts are usually internet bank accounts - you will need to do your banking online.
